Entering the workforce can be both exciting and daunting. The transition from academic life to professional settings is a significant milestone, marking the beginning of a new chapter filled with responsibilities and opportunities. Starting your first grown-up job brings a mix of emotions, from anticipation to anxiety. However, with the right approach, you can make a positive impression on your employer and set the stage for a successful career. Here are nine ways to wow your employer from day one.

1. Arrive Early and Be Prepared

Punctuality is a simple yet powerful way to demonstrate your commitment and reliability. Arriving early not only shows that you value your employer’s time but also gives you a chance to settle in and prepare for the day ahead. Ensure that you have all the necessary tools and information to start your tasks efficiently. Being prepared means reviewing any materials provided beforehand, understanding your role, and having questions ready if needed. This proactive approach will showcase your dedication and eagerness to contribute from the get-go.

2. Dress Appropriately

First impressions matter, and how you present yourself can significantly impact how you are perceived. Dressing appropriately for your workplace demonstrates respect for the company culture and the professional environment. Research the company’s dress code beforehand and adhere to it, whether it’s formal, business casual, or more relaxed. Your attire should reflect professionalism and attention to detail, helping to establish you as a serious and committed employee.

3. Show Enthusiasm and Positivity

A positive attitude can be contagious and can significantly influence your workplace environment. Approach your new job with enthusiasm and a willingness to learn. Smile, introduce yourself to colleagues, and show genuine interest in your new role. This positive demeanor will make you approachable and help build rapport with your team. Employers appreciate employees who are motivated and excited about their work, as it often translates into higher productivity and a better team dynamic.

4. Listen and Learn

In the initial days of your job, prioritize listening and learning over speaking. Pay close attention to the instructions and feedback from your supervisors and colleagues. This not only helps you understand your responsibilities better but also demonstrates respect for the knowledge and experience of your peers. Taking notes during meetings and training sessions can be beneficial. This active listening approach will help you quickly adapt to your new role and show your employer that you are attentive and eager to grow.

5. Take Initiative

While it is essential to listen and learn, taking initiative is equally important. Look for opportunities to go above and beyond your assigned tasks. If you finish your work early, ask for additional assignments or offer to help a colleague. Suggesting improvements or new ideas can also show your proactive mindset. However, ensure that you balance initiative with respect for established processes and protocols. Employers value employees who are proactive and demonstrate a willingness to contribute to the team’s success.

6. Build Relationships

Building strong relationships with your colleagues is crucial for a positive work experience and career growth. Take the time to get to know your team members and understand their roles and responsibilities. Engage in conversations during breaks or team activities, and participate in social events if possible. Building these connections can lead to a supportive network within the company, making your work environment more enjoyable and collaborative. It also shows your employer that you are a team player who values interpersonal relationships.

7. Be Reliable and Accountable

Reliability is a key trait that employers look for in their employees. Ensure that you meet deadlines, complete tasks accurately, and follow through on your commitments. If you encounter challenges, communicate them promptly and seek assistance if needed. Being accountable for your work, both successes and mistakes, demonstrates integrity and responsibility. This reliability builds trust with your employer and colleagues, establishing you as a dependable member of the team.

8. Embrace Feedback

Feedback is an essential component of professional growth. Embrace both positive and constructive feedback with an open mind. Use it as an opportunity to improve your skills and performance. Showing that you can accept and act on feedback demonstrates your commitment to personal and professional development. Additionally, seeking feedback proactively can show your employer that you are dedicated to continuous improvement. Regularly asking for input on your work can help you refine your skills and better align with your employer’s expectations.

9. Stay Organized

Organization is critical for managing your tasks efficiently and maintaining productivity. Keep track of your assignments, deadlines, and meetings using tools such as planners, calendars, or digital apps. An organized approach helps prevent missed deadlines and ensures that you can balance multiple responsibilities effectively. It also demonstrates your ability to manage your workload and contribute to the team’s overall efficiency. Staying organized helps you stay focused and can significantly reduce work-related stress.
